    Poker Stars, $0.44 Buy-in (100/200 blinds, 25 ante) No Limit Hold'em Tournament, 3 Players
    Poker Tools Powered By Holdem Manager - The Ultimate Poker Software Suite. View Hand #37305189

    Hero (BTN): 3,086 (15.4 bb)
    SB: 3,247 (16.2 bb)
    BB: 7,167 (35.8 bb)

    Preflop: Hero is BTN with T A
    Hero raises to 400, SB raises to 3,222 and is all-in, 2 folds

    Spoiler:
    Results: 1,075 pot
    SB mucked and won 1,075 (650 net)



    Get the Flash Player to use the Hold'em Manager Replayer.


    Villain was unknown.
    Could be his first resteal so I folded. How was the standard play vs. unknow? What you guys think about a push pre? Too deep with 15BB?

    Have the blinds just gone up or are they about to go up again? A shove is fine either way with 15bbs. As played I think you have to call the shove. There is opponents who will never be doing this with worse than A10 but plenty of players interpret your raise as a steal attempt and move in here with any ace or broadway hands like KQ, KJ.
